MANUEL-TURIZO
Manuel Turizo (full name Manuel Turizo Zapata) is an urbano and reggaeton singer songwriter and multi-instrumentalist from Colombia whose trademark is his smooth buttery tenor singing voice. His international success has seen him enter mainstream Latin music. His 2016 hit Una Lady Como Tu was the winner of a Colombian Kids Choice Award for Favorite Song in 2017. His debut album was a long-player ADN to the Medellin-based company Sony, which is distributed by La Industria Inc. The album reached number 8 within the Top Latin Albums Chart. The following year, he teamed up with Ozuna to make Vaina Loca, which was a Top Five hit. In 2020 he released the chart-topping sophomore album Dopamina as well as co-produced Mala Influencia with Noriel. In 2021, he also performed the duet for TINI's streaming popular single Maldita Foto. The hit song La Bachata from 2000 was released in 2023. Turizo was raised in a musical household his mother and older brother are both musicians. In his interviews, he's described participating in music as compulsory. In his childhood he was taught how to perform on the piano, saxophone as well as guitar. His first career choice was to become a vet But his older brother Julian was able to convince him singing with a Cuban instructor. The end result, finding out that he was blessed with the ability to sing, altered the direction of his life.
